Why AI matters at this scale
Beston Rides operates in a niche but globally competitive market: manufacturing and exporting large-scale amusement equipment. With 201-500 employees and an estimated $45M in revenue, the company sits in the mid-market "sweet spot" where AI adoption is no longer optional for maintaining margins. Margins in equipment wholesale are typically thin (5-15%), and the pressure from lower-cost manufacturers in Asia is intense. AI offers a path to differentiate not just on price, but on service, safety, and speed—transforming Beston from a pure equipment vendor into a technology-enabled partner for amusement parks worldwide.
Three concrete AI opportunities
1. Predictive maintenance as a service is the highest-impact opportunity. By embedding IoT sensors in exported rides and applying machine learning to operational data, Beston can predict bearing failures, motor degradation, or structural fatigue weeks in advance. This allows customers to schedule maintenance during off-hours, avoiding costly downtime. The ROI is twofold: Beston can charge a recurring subscription for the monitoring service (boosting lifetime value per customer) and reduce warranty claims by 20-30%. For a ride that generates $5,000/day in ticket revenue, preventing just one unplanned outage pays for the annual service.
2. AI-driven logistics and supply chain optimization addresses a major cost center. Shipping oversized ride components from factories to international ports involves complex freight decisions. Machine learning models trained on historical shipping data, fuel costs, and customs delays can recommend optimal routes and container configurations, potentially saving 10-15% on logistics—translating to $500K+ annually. This is a high-ROI, lower-risk project that builds internal AI capabilities.
3. Generative AI for design acceleration can compress the 6-12 month custom ride design cycle. Using tools like generative adversarial networks (GANs) or large language models trained on engineering specs, the design team can generate dozens of concept variations in hours instead of weeks. This allows faster response to RFPs and more creative, data-informed designs that meet regional safety standards. The ROI is measured in faster deal closure and higher win rates on custom projects.
Deployment risks specific to this size band
Mid-market manufacturers face unique AI risks. First, data scarcity: unlike large enterprises, Beston may lack the volume of structured operational data needed to train robust models from scratch. Mitigation involves starting with pre-trained models and transfer learning. Second, talent gaps: hiring data scientists in Spring Valley, Nevada is challenging; partnering with a specialized AI consultancy or using low-code AI platforms is more realistic. Third, integration complexity: legacy ERP and CAD systems may not expose APIs easily, requiring middleware investment. A phased approach—starting with a standalone chatbot or cloud-based logistics tool—minimizes disruption while proving value before tackling deeper product integration.
